Programmer - Database Developer

York Region District School Board
British Columbia, Canada
$84.7K-$105.9K a year
Permanent
Full-time

PROGRAMMER - DATABASE DEVELOPER (CONTINUING) School District No. 42 meets the learning needs of over 16,000 students of all ages in Maple Ridge and Pitt Meadows, and is defined by its determination to keep student learning and growth at the heart of all its decisions.

With an annual budget of over $200M and over 2,000 staff, the school district provides K-12 educational services in 22 elementary schools, six secondary schools, and two alternate schools.

It also provides a variety of certificate programs and relevant quality life-long learning opportunities through Ridge Meadows College and Continuing Education.

For more information about our school district, visit Reporting to the Senior Manager, Information Technology, this position is responsible for the programming and administration of the district’s database servers and custom web-based software applications.

Work will include complex analysis, design, programming, administration, and configuration of databases as well as application development in server, desktop / laptop and tablet / mobile environments.

Software development will be primary done in Microsoft Visual Studio utilizing C# and SQL. Frontend development software is also created using CSS, HTML, and JavaScript.

Duties may include providing customer support, assistance with more complex work or troubleshooting software issues. RESPONSIBILITIES1.

Gathers technical requirements, plans, designs, tests, maintains and supports District databases and custom web-based software applications.

2. Assists in the design, implementation and documentation of complex systems and centralized District computer resources.

3. Tests, evaluates, modifies and maintains current and new hardware / software, computer programs and systems to improve workflow.

4. Manages, maintains, enhances, secures and reports on data and systems for optimal performance, including highly confidential systems and databases such as Payroll, Human Resources and Financial Information systems.

5. Conducts technical research on system upgrades to determine feasibility, cost, and time required and compatibility with current systems.

6. Prepares detailed flow charts, and diagrams outlining system capabilities and processes; writes systems and application documentation.

7. Provides functional support and expands capabilities in the areas of programming and administration.8. Provides leadership, mentoring, guidance and advice to staff as required.

9. Continuously upgrades skills to keep abreast of new technology.10. Performs other related duties as required. QUALIFICATIONS1.

A BCIT or equivalent post-secondary degree in Computer Sciences / Information Systems and four (4) years of directly related experience, or equivalent combination of education and experience.

2. Microsoft Certified Database Administrators (MCDBAs) or Microsoft Certified Application Developers (MCADs) certification and / or a minimum of 4 years of direct database development.

3. Extensive knowledge and experience with C# and Transact-SQL.4. Extensive knowledge and experience with CSS, HTML, and JavaScript.

5. Extensive experience in developing software solutions in MS Visual Studio.6. Experience designing and writing software scripts to automate routine tasks and simplify system administration.

7. Demonstrated ability as a team player with effective communication and problem-solving skills.8. A self-starter with proven initiative in developing and executing IT projects and identifying opportunities for efficiencies.

9. A valid BC Driver’s License.This is a full-time, permanent position. The salary range is $84,730-105,913, plus an excellent comprehensive benefits package.

To apply, please click "apply online" below and submit your cover letter, resume, district application form and supporting documentation.

The district appreciates the interest of all applicants, however, only those selected for an interview will be contacted.

For more information about our School District please visit : http : / / www.sd42.ca / our-district / Our staff members are the foundation of our system.

When you join our school district, you become part of a talented community of educators and support staff dedicated to enriching the lives of all students and helping them achieve success.

30+ days ago
Related jobs
York Region District School Board
British Columbia, Canada

PROGRAMMER - DATABASE DEVELOPER (CONTINUING) School District No. Microsoft Certified Database Administrators (MCDBAs) or Microsoft Certified Application Developers (MCADs) certification and/or a minimum of 4 years of direct database development. For more information about our school district, visit ...

Promoted
TRADOGRAM
Canada

We are currently seeking a proactive and results-driven Database Administrator (DBA) to join our product team. In this role, you’ll be responsible for maintaining and optimizing our MySQL databases, collaborating with developers, and supporting the scalability and performance of our SaaS platform. M...

Promoted
Myticas Consulting
Vancouver, British Columbia

This role involves designing, implementing, and maintaining data engineering solutions with a primary focus on Microsoft Fabric. Adhere to best practices in data engineering, including code modularity, documentation, and version control. ADF, Data Lake, Azure Synapse, Azure SQL, and Databricks). The...

Promoted
Centrilogic
Canada

Knowledge and experience with Oracle Database 19c and Oracle EBS. Must be able to obtain and maintain Oracle Certifications pertaining to Oracle Database and Oracle Cloud Infrastructure. ...

Promoted
Direct IT Recruiting Inc., WBE Canada Certified
Canada
Remote

SKILLS: Senior Developer, Ellucian Banner, PL/SQL, API Development, Ellucian Argos, Cohorts, JavaScript, HTML, CSS. Process Refinement: Evaluating and refining the English and Math processes, ensuring the correct application of transfer credits through the relevant Banner tables (PL/SQL and. Impleme...

Promoted
tsworks
Vancouver, British Columbia

Lead a team of data analysts to execute the data strategy and maintain the ecosystem. Canada, Inc is seeking driven and motivated Lead Data Analyst to join its Digital Services Team. Experience on cloud data ecosystems AWS (Amazon Web Services) Redshift, Azure Synapse, Snowflake or Data Bricks . Lev...

Promoted
Trader Interactive
Port Moody, British Columbia

As a Senior Software Engineer in our Merlin group, you will have the opportunity to make a significant impact on the present and future of Trader Interactive, helping to spearhead the implementation of the next generation of technology, concepts and methods in specialty vehicle marketplaces. You wil...

Promoted
Remarcable Inc.
Vancouver, British Columbia

We are seeking a resourceful and talented Software Engineer to join our team and contribute to the ongoing growth and development of our platform. Bachelor’s Degree in Computer Science, Software Engineering or related degree. As Remarcable’s latest member of the Engineering team, you wil...

Snaphunt
Canada

Must possess at least 6-7 years of proven experience as a Full Stack Developer or similar role, with a strong portfolio of web applications and projects. ...

KPMG
Canada, Canada

The CCoE Full-Stack Application Developer will have a key role in the development of the platform for custom applications and homegrown cloud services. Develop the core assets of the managed services platform as a senior full-stack developer. Full stack (frontend and back-end) design patterns, and c...